The manual is inaccurate and nearly useless for programming. This thing is a to program from the unit! It is probably a lot easier to program with software.
The two biggest criticisms of the TYT TH-9000D are the lack of a cooling fan, and even more significantly, the painfully non-intuitive programming. Some wise ham operators have added a cooling fan on the back of the unit using a PC CPU cooling fan or something similar, especially when used as a base station. The manufacture should have equipped it with a rear cooling fan, but they did not. However, it will get very hot when operating on high power, or long QSOs on medium power.
